- How should material be stored on arrival?
- Lyophilized reference compounds are kept sealed and refrigerated at 2–8 °C for short-term working stock, or frozen at −20 °C or colder for long-term archive. Once reconstituted, solution is refrigerated, protected from light, and treated as a consumable.
